Empowering Learning are working with a highly successful school situated in the area of Harlow. The school are looking for an efficient, enthusiastic individual with excellent communication skills to provide support for pupils. Previous experience of working with teachers and supporting students is desirable although not essential. A high standard of literacy and numeracy is essential for this post, as is the enthusiasm to help raise the achievement of students.

What we need from you:

Set a good example in terms of dress, punctuality and attendance
Promote the welfare of children and to support the school in safeguarding children though following relevant policies and procedures
Be able to support students with following their behaviour plans and strategies
Be proactive in matters of Health and Safety
Communicate efficiently with the Senior Leadership Team and members of staff
